全面解析brat标注工具及其在GitHub上的应用

什么是brat标注工具?

brat标注工具是一款基于网页的标注工具,主要用于文本数据的标注。其设计理念是提供一个用户友好的界面,使得研究人员、数据科学家和语言学家能够高效地进行文本注释。brat能够处理多种类型的标注任务,包括实体识别、关系标注和事件标注。

brat标注工具的功能特点

  • 直观的用户界面:brat具有易于操作的网页界面,用户可以通过简单的点击和拖拽进行标注。
  • 实时标注反馈:系统提供即时的标注反馈,使得用户能够实时查看自己的标注结果。
  • 多用户协作:brat支持多用户协作,用户可以在同一个项目中共同工作,提高标注的效率。
  • 可定制化:用户可以根据需求定制标注类型和标注界面,灵活满足不同项目的需要。

如何在GitHub上获取brat标注工具

brat标注工具的源代码托管在GitHub上,用户可以通过以下步骤获取并使用该工具:

  1. 访问GitHub页面:打开brat标注工具的GitHub页面 以获取最新的代码和更新。

  2. 克隆项目:使用git clone命令将项目克隆到本地。 bash git clone https://github.com/nlplab/brat.git

  3. 安装依赖:根据项目的说明文档安装所需的依赖。

  4. 启动服务器:按照说明启动本地服务器,用户即可在浏览器中访问brat进行标注。

brat标注工具的应用场景

brat标注工具适用于多种领域,以下是一些具体的应用场景:

  • 自然语言处理:在文本处理和分析中,brat被广泛应用于训练和评估自然语言处理模型。
  • 生物信息学:生物领域的研究者使用brat来标注基因组数据及其相关的生物实体。
  • 社交媒体分析:通过标注社交媒体数据,研究人员可以分析用户行为和情感。

brat标注工具的优缺点

优点

  • 易于使用:用户友好的设计使得非专业人士也能快速上手。
  • 灵活性高:支持多种类型的标注,适用于各种项目。
  • 开源社区支持:拥有强大的开源社区,用户可以随时获取帮助和更新。

缺点

  • 学习曲线:尽管界面友好,但对新手用户来说,全面掌握所有功能可能需要一定时间。
  • 性能限制:处理大量数据时,可能会出现性能瓶颈。

brat标注工具的常见问题解答 (FAQ)

brat标注工具是否免费?

是的,brat标注工具是开源的,任何人都可以免费下载和使用,适合学术研究和个人项目。

brat标注工具支持哪些操作系统?

brat标注工具是基于网页的,理论上可以在任何操作系统上运行,只需有支持现代浏览器的设备即可。

如何在brat中添加自定义标注类型?

用户可以通过编辑配置文件来自定义标注类型,具体步骤可以参考官方文档

brat标注工具的标注结果如何导出?

用户可以将标注结果导出为多种格式,包括JSON和TXT格式,以便后续分析和处理。

brat标注工具支持多语言标注吗?

是的,brat标注工具支持多种语言的文本标注,用户可以根据需要进行设置。

总结

brat标注工具作为一种功能强大且易于使用的文本标注工具,已在学术界和工业界得到了广泛应用。其在GitHub上的开源特性使得更多的研究人员和开发者能够利用这一工具进行创新和研究。无论是进行自然语言处理还是其他领域的数据标注,brat都是一个值得尝试的工具。

正文完